#
# General
#
set -gs escape-time 50 # avoid delays with ESC in vim
set -gs repeat-time 1000 # allow 1 second for multiple commands
set -g base-index 1 # start window numbering from 1
set -g history-limit 20000 # remember longer history
setw -g automatic-rename on # automatically rename windows
setw -g mouse on # enable mouse support
setw -g pane-base-index 1 # start pane numbering from 1
# Set $TERM and force 256 colors.
# https://github.com/tmux/tmux/wiki/FAQ#how-do-i-use-a-256-colour-terminal
set -g default-terminal 'screen-256color'
